@riot removing strength of ages removes playstyle choices. here are examples

Msatie·10/20/2016, 6:23:32 PM·2 votes·672 views

many times i would like to play kat with this build

boots, visage, deadmans, warmogs, liandry, rylai, strength of ages

with this build kat would be very tanky and durable, and still output decent levels of damage. and her bouncing Q would bounce to 6 people dealing damage and applying liandry rylai slow/burn. it was very decent bouncing poke on a low cooldown (35% cdr if you ran 15% cdr quints which i did). or 40% cdr if you throw in three CDR blues too

anyway. this kat playstyle was fun and unique and didnt feel overpowered at all

i see nothing wrong with having the OPTION/CHOICE to spend your resources into tank stats to SHOCKING be tankier and do less damage

with my tank kat build, i WAS doing LESS DAMAGE, and i was TANKIER. i believe players should have this fair trade off option on what to spend stats into

and next. tank items are generally 50% stronger than damage items in pure gold value and "combat power". this is because if damage items were as strong as tank items in gold value then there would be no point to buy tank items.

when a tank "goes in" hes usually tanking 5 enemies are once. so his items NEED to have extra gold value for him to survive for more than 2 seconds

so this is why strength of ages gave 300 health, and thunderlords dealt ~240 magic damage (at lvl18 fullbuild). so thunderlords would come down to dealing 120 actual damage past MR (most people have 100 MR at lvl18) while strength of ages gave 300 health

this was a totally resonable "value" for both masterys considering one gave TANKNESS and one gave DAMAGE

now with strength of ages removed, you lose the "general tankness" mastery and pretty much all champs will just get a damage mastery instead (thunderlords or deathfire fervor)

so in the end, my kat build does not change (i can still buy those tank items) but i will just have 300 less health

which feels dumb. because i wanted to spend my mastery power into more tankness. to buff up the build and be even tankier. but now i cant do that

so removing strength of ages doesnt even do much, it just feels dumb, because we can STILL put our GOLD into tank stats, we just cant spend our mastery into tank stats anymore? that feels restricting for no reason, riot
